Internal Medicine

Internal Medicine is a field of medicine aimed at preventing, diagnosing, and treating diseases that affect adults. It is a specialty concerned with the diagnosis, treatment and prevention of disease in adults. Internists focus on the diagnosis and medical treatment of diseases or conditions that affect adults, such as hypertension, diabetes, heart disease, infectious diseases, and cancer. Internists are often called upon to manage a patient's long-term health, provide consultations to other physicians, and provide preventive care. Internal Medicine is a very important field of medicine, and its principles are used in many specialties including family medicine, pediatrics, geriatrics, neurology, and endocrinology. In addition, internal medicine is used in many other fields, including public health and epidemiology.
